The probability of saving a penalty kick from the opposing team is .617 for a soccer goalie. If 7 penalty kicks are shot at the
dsp73

Answer:

0.2754

Step-by-step explanation:

Probability of saving a penalty kick = 0.617

p = 0.617 ; q = 1 - p = 1 - 0.617 = 0.383

number of trials, n = 7

Number of saves, x = 5

Using the binomial probability relation :

P(x = x) = nCx * p^x * q^(n-x)

P(x = 5) = 7C5 * 0.617^5 * 0.383^2

P(x = 5) = 21 * 0.0894181 * 0.146689

P(x = 5) = 0.2754
